demeter -
(Greek mythology) goddess of fertility and protector of marriage in ancient mythology; counterpart of Roman Ceres

Demeter is the goddess of farming in Greek mythology. She is one of the Twelve Olympians. She is the daughter of Kronos and Rhea, and also the sister of Zeus. As a fertility goddess, she is sometimes identified with Rhea and Gaia. She is the mother of Persephone. Demeter brings forth fruits of the earth, particularly the various grains. Her sacred animals were the snake and the pig. She is also the sister of Hara, Zeus,Posiden and Hades. Demeter was most often kind and generous.
